Which is the longest Rail route in India? |
A. | Dibrugarh to Kanyakumari |
B. | Mangalore to Jammu |
C. | Tirunelveli Jammu |
D. | None of these |
Answer» A. Dibrugarh to Kanyakumari | |
Explanation: Dibrugarh – Kanyakumari Vivek Express. This weekly train, numbered 15905/15906, is currently the longest train route in the Indian Subcontinent. |
